Otra opcion que me sirve cuando se trata de expreciones compuestas de muchos niveles es utilizar al Cross Apply:
Código SQL:
Ver originalSELECT object_id,
Alias1,
Alias2,
Alias3
FROM sys.objects
CROSS Apply (SELECT object_id+1 AS Alias1) T1
CROSS Apply (SELECT Alias1+2 AS Alias2) T2
CROSS Apply (SELECT Alias2+3 AS Alias3) T3;